HouseSpecial’s ‘Lamentation’ Screening at the New Hollywood Theatre @PDX

Portland animation studio HouseSpecial announces the opening screening of ­their latest short film Lamentation at The Hollywood Theatre @PDX, the new movie theatre in Portland’s airport (C Concourse), beginning on February 23, 2017 and running regularly through the Spring.

The short film is inspired by Portland’s own world-renowned Pink Martini’s rendition of the sorrowful Romanian ballad Până când nu te iubeam (Before I Fell in Love with You), with vocals by Storm Large. Director Kirk Kelley, Founding Partner/Creative Director of HouseSpecial, employed traditional stop-motion animation, in-camera VFX and CG elements combined with high-speed footage captured in practical environments. Miu Miu Women’s Stories Features Portland, Carmen Lynch – Directed By Chloë Sevigny

Fashion brand Miu Mi, created an ongoing short film series, Women’s Tales, back in 2012, initially in partnership with the Venice Film Festival.  Miu Miu commissions two films a year.  The short films must use Miu Miu’s clothing line as costumes, and only female directors have been invited to participate.  Last year, Chloë Sevigny (a big fan of the fashion line) directed comedienne, Carmen Lynch,  in film no. 13, “Carmen“, and with David Cress (Co-Producer), Kevin Sullivan,(Line Producer) Eric Edwards (DP),  and many of the crew from “Portlandia”, they shot here in Portland.  Continue reading... “Miu Miu Women’s Stories Features Portland, Carmen Lynch – Directed By Chloë Sevigny”

Horror Film Festival Haunts Southern Oregon On Nov. 12th

official-poster-2016Returning to Ashland, OR for it’s 8th installment, the Killer Valley Horror Film Festival (KVHFF) is a celebration of independent horror and science fiction movies from around the globe. A one-night affair, geared to film-goers 18 years and older, the festival showcases genres that are arguably the most fun for independent filmmakers to create, and provides an atmosphere for horror fans to watch in a more social environment than a typical theater setting. Audiences often dress in costume, and the festival offers Special FX Makeup Booths in case viewers want to feel like a zombie for the night.
